Ring with double cartouche of Horemheb

This ring is characterized by a double cartouche bezel in which are engraved the first name and the name of the last sovereign of the XVIII Dynasty, Horemheb.

More info

This prized jewel testifies to the skill of Egyptian craftsmen in working with hard stones such as jasper. The material was chosen for the magical value attributed to red jasper to protect people and keep hostile forces away, enhanced by the power of the name of the sovereign in the shenu ring of the cartouche.

Provenance: Provenance unknown. Palagi Collection (Nizzoli)
Datation: 18th dynasty: reign of Horemheb (1319–1292 B C)
Material: Red jasper
Dimensions: cm 2,4 x 2,2 x 1
Inventory #: EG 453
